Postman接口测试工具是一款专门为Windows系统提供的强大网页调试工具,该软件为你提供强大的功能,支持Web API和HTTP 请求调试,可以帮助你快速完成网络程序的开发工作,软件门槛低,很容易入手,喜欢的赶快来试试吧!接口测试其实很普遍,无论你是做什么测试,功能、自动化亦或是性能测试,都会或多或少接触到接口。在测试过程中,很多场景都需要测试人员针对某个接口进行测试,并针对不同类型的接口设计不同的测试方案,这时如果有一款功能强大的接口测试工具,就快速完成繁琐工作,大幅提升工作效率。

Postman接口测试工具宣传图

【功能说明】

  1. 多种HTTP请求支持

  Postman全面支持GET、POST、PUT、DELETE、PATCH、HEAD、OPTIONS等所有HTTP请求方法,同时也支持RESTful API、SOAP协议和GraphQL请求。用户可以轻松配置请求URL、请求头、请求体(包括JSON、XML、form-data、x-www-form-urlencoded、binary等多种格式),并能够通过Params面板以表格方式快速添加URL查询参数。

  2. 环境变量与参数化管理

  Postman提供了完善的变量管理体系,包括全局变量(Global)、环境变量(Environment)、集合变量(Collection)和数据变量(Data)四个层级。用户可以创建多个环境(如开发环境、测试环境、生产环境),每个环境配置不同的变量值(如base_url、token等),通过{{variable_name}}语法在请求中引用。变量优先级从高到低依次为:Data > Local > Environment > Global > Collection。

  3. 请求前脚本与测试脚本(Pre-request Script & Tests)

  Postman内置了基于JavaScript的脚本编辑器。Pre-request Script在请求发送前执行,可用于生成动态参数(如时间戳、随机数、签名计算等);Tests在请求响应后执行,用于编写断言验证结果。Postman内置Chai断言库,提供pm.test()、pm.expect()、pm.response.to.have.status()等丰富的断言方法。

  4. Collection集合管理

  Collection相当于一个接口项目或测试计划,用户可以将相关接口归类组织,支持无限级子文件夹嵌套。集合层面可统一设置授权方式、公共前置脚本、公共断言脚本,方便批量管理。集合支持导出为JSON文件分享给他人,也可通过Import导入他人的集合。

  5. Collection Runner批量执行

  Runner工具支持选择集合中的全部或部分接口进行批量执行,可设置迭代次数,支持导入CSV、JSON、TXT等格式的数据文件实现数据驱动测试。执行完成后会生成详细的测试报告,展示每个请求的通过/失败状态、响应时间等信息。

  6. Newman命令行工具

  Newman是Postman的命令行运行器,通过npm install -g newman安装后,可在终端中使用newman run collection.json命令执行Postman集合。这使得Postman能够无缝集成到Jenkins、GitLab CI等CI/CD流水线中,实现接口自动化测试的持续集成。

功能说明配图1

【软件优势】

  界面简洁直观,零门槛上手

  Postman采用清晰的双栏布局——左侧为接口管理区(History历史记录、Collections集合),右侧为接口设计区(请求区和响应区)。整个界面设计以用户体验为核心,即使是完全没有编程基础的测试人员,也能在几分钟内完成第一个接口请求的发送和结果查看。

  脚本能力强大但不强制

  Postman的脚本使用标准JavaScript语法,内置了pm对象提供丰富的API(如pm.environment.set、pm.globals.get、pm.response.json()等)。对于简单场景,用户完全可以通过可视化界面完成所有操作;对于复杂场景(如接口关联、动态签名、数据加密),脚本能力又能提供足够的灵活性。

软件优势配图1

【使用指南】

  第一步:创建环境与变量

  点击右上角"环境管理"图标(眼睛形状),点击"Add"创建新环境(如命名为"测试环境"),添加所需变量(如base_url = https://api.example.com,token = 空)。如有多个环境,分别创建"开发环境""生产环境"等。

  第二步:创建Collection并添加请求

  点击左侧Collections区域的"+"号新建Collection(如命名为"用户管理接口"),在集合上右键选择"Add Request"新建请求。在请求界面选择请求方法(GET/POST等),输入请求URL(如{{base_url}}/users/login),在Headers中添加Content-Type: application/json等必要请求头,在Body的raw选项中选择JSON格式并填写请求体数据,最后点击"Send"发送请求。

【更新内容】

  1.将bug扫地出门进行到底

  2.有史以来最稳定版本

下载地址

远程下载